I have just been contacted by a couple of people who have told me that Star Vistas is now being shipped and delivered in the U.K.  A quick check on Amazon U.K. says delivery in 2-days if ordered now using Special Delivery – so Amazon must have their stock in too.  So to all of you that have been patiently waiting over the last few months – thank you – and it looks like the long wait is at last, finally over 🙂

